Summary
Enforces State, County, and Municipal laws, rules, and regulations for the protection and security of persons and property of Clemson University. Performs other duties as assigned.
45% - Essential - LAW ENFORCEMENT:
Patrols assigned area to detect violations and enforce State, County and Municipal laws, rules and regulations for the protection and security of persons and property of Clemson University. Directs pedestrian and vehicular traffic. Installs and removes traffic control devices as needed. Issues summons and takes enforcement action when needed. Participates in traffic safety programs and initiatives. Exercises arrest powers as appropriate. Completes booking reports, fingerprints and photographs. Responds to disturbances, performs investigations, collects evidence and completes reports. Ability to work flexible schedules - day and/or night, rotating shifts, holidays, weekends, special events - based on the needs of the department.
25% - Essential - Investigating and Crime Scene Management:
Investigates complaints and interviews victims, witnesses, and participants. Photographs and sketches crime scenes. Collects evidence and informs superiors. Works field incidents to completion and conducts investigation follow ups as needed.
20% - Essential - Civic Responsibilities:
Performs duties associated with crime prevention. Assists disabled motorists. Reports safety hazards, prepares police reports and other activity reports. Conducts public outreach/engagement activities. Practices modern, community-oriented policing concepts and supports the CUPD/Residential Life Housing Liaison and CUPD Affinity Group Liason programs.
10% - Essential - Administrative Support:
Prepares cases for court presentation. Presents cases in the Clemson University Municipal Court. Forwards documents for Circuit Court cases to the Solicitor's Office and testifies in court.

Minimum Requirements:
Education - High School or Equivalent
Licenses - Drivers License Class D normal
Work Exp 0-3+ years
Must pass a background investigation.
Must obtain Class I LEO Certification from the SC Criminal Justice Academy within 1 year from hire date.
Must complete department Police Training Officer (PTO) Program within 1 year from hire date.
Qualifications
Preferred Requirements:
Education - 1st associate's degree
SCCJA Class I LEO Certification
